Requesting approval to stage the City's annual Veterans Day Parade in downtown Aurora on Tuesday, November 11, 2014 beginning at 10:15 am.
body
PURPOSE:
The Veterans Day Parade honors our current and past military with both a parade and ceremony.
 
BACKGROUND:
This event is hosted by the City of Aurora and the Aurora Veterans Advisory Council. Staging begins at 9:15 on Benton between Broadway and Stolp.  Step off is at 10:15 at the corner of Benton and Broadway, the parade continues to Downer, turns west and ends at the G.A.R. After the parade a ceremony with a guest speaker, rifle salute and moment of silence is conducted in front of the Grand Army of the Republic Museum.
 
DISCUSSION:
The event is budgeted from account # 101-1341-450.53-10.
 
IMPACT STATEMENT:
Street closures: Benton from Stolp to Broadway from 9:00 am to 10:30 am; Broadway for the parade only, 10:15 to 10:25; Downer from Broadway to Stolp from 10:00 am to 11:30 am.
City Services:
Electrical: Power at the outside G.A.R. outlets
Downtown Maintenance: Chairs, flags, podium, and table at G.A.R.
MVPS: Place "No Parking" signage along parade route on Monday, November 10th end of day, Q lot gates open
Streets: Place barricades as instructed on attached map and spreadsheet
APD and EMA: assist with street closures along with lead and end squads for parade
Central Services: Key for G.A.R. flagpole
